#613164 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#613164 is composed of 38% red, 19.2%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3% cyan, 51%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 296.5 degrees, a saturation of 34.2% and a lightness of 29.2%. #613164 color hex could be obtained by blending #c262c8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#613164

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080408 is the darkest color, while #fcfafc is the lightest one.

Tones of #613164

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d484d is the less saturated color, while #890392 is the most saturated one.
